The Significance of Data Management in Orthopedic Surgery Practices

Orthopedic surgery practices generate vast amounts of data daily, including patient records, imaging results, treatment plans, and billing information. Efficiently managing this data is crucial for several reasons. Firstly, it enables healthcare providers to quickly access relevant information, making it easier to make informed decisions about patient care. Secondly, accurate data management helps practices maintain regulatory compliance with HIPAA and other healthcare regulations. Lastly, effective data management can streamline operations, reducing administrative burdens and costs.

Challenges Faced by Orthopedic Practices in Tennessee

Despite the importance of data management, orthopedic practices in Tennessee often encounter several challenges. These challenges include:

  • Lack of centralized data systems: Many practices still rely on paper-based records or multiple electronic systems that don’t communicate effectively, leading to data fragmentation and inefficiencies.
  • Data security concerns: With the increasing number of data breaches in the healthcare industry, ensuring the security and privacy of patient data is more critical than ever.
  • Staff training and technological barriers: Many practices struggle to train their staff on data management best practices and new technologies, hindering their ability to fully utilize the potential of digital solutions.

Best Practices for Effective Data Management

To overcome these challenges, orthopedic practices in Tennessee can implement the following best practices:

  • Centralize Data Systems: Practices should invest in a robust, cloud-based electronic health records (EHR) system that serves as a centralized repository for all patient data. This allows for seamless data sharing among providers and improved data accessibility.
  • Implement Data Security Measures: Data security should be a top priority for practices. They should adopt robust data encryption protocols, implement access controls, and conduct regular security audits to identify and address vulnerabilities.
  • Develop a Data Analytics Strategy: Practices should leverage data analytics tools to gain insights into their operations. By analyzing data, they can identify areas for improvement, such as optimizing appointment scheduling or reducing wait times.
  • Provide Staff Training: Regular training sessions should be conducted to educate staff on data management best practices, the proper use of technology, and the importance of data security. This will ensure that all team members are equipped to handle data effectively.

Evaluating Data Management Vendors and Services

When selecting a data management vendor or service, orthopedic practices in Tennessee should consider the following factors:

  • Specialization in Orthopedic Data Solutions: Look for vendors with experience and expertise in the orthopedic field. They should understand the unique challenges and requirements of orthopedic data management.
  • Scalability and Flexibility: Choose a solution that can scale with the practice’s growth and adapt to changing needs. It should integrate seamlessly with other systems, such as billing and patient engagement platforms.
  • Data Security and Compliance: Ensure that the vendor prioritizes data security and complies with HIPAA regulations. Ask about their data backup protocols, disaster recovery plans, and cybersecurity measures.
  • User-Friendly Interface: Opt for a solution with a user-friendly interface to minimize training requirements and ensure widespread adoption among staff.

Common Mistakes to Avoid

Orthopedic practices in Tennessee often make the following mistakes related to data management:

  • Lack of Regular Data Backups: Failing to backup data regularly can lead to permanent data loss in the event of a breach or system failure. Practices should have robust backup protocols in place.
  • Outdated Software and Systems: Using outdated software can create vulnerabilities that hackers can exploit. Practices should regularly update their systems and software to ensure they have the latest security patches.
  • Inefficient Data Storage: Storing data on local servers or legacy systems can lead to bottlenecks and inefficiencies. Practices should consider moving to cloud-based storage solutions.
  • Lack of Disaster Recovery Plan: A disaster recovery plan is essential to ensure business continuity in the event of a major incident. Practices should have a plan in place to protect data and restore operations quickly.
